Statue of Liberty

posted by hweingarten on 21 July 2011 at 10:00

We didn't book our tickets in advance so we had no choice but to just look up and the great lady, but it was really cool just to be there. If you want to see the views you'll have to be organised so make sure you book ahead!

MoMA

posted by fwhittier on 18 February 2011 at 10:00

The Museum of Modern Art went straight in right near the top of the best museums i've been to! So many famous artworks i've been dying to see, and a great collection all round too. Seeing Van Gogh's Starry Night and one of Monet's huge waterlillies was the absolute highlight of my trip.
